クラス関係 – プログラミング – Home

通知
すべてクリア

[解決済] クラス関係


クロス
 クロス
(@クロス)
ゲスト
結合: 17年前
投稿: 2
Topic starter  

 appleというクラスと、orenziというクラス、そしてgrapeというクラスがある場合、
grapeクラスから、appleクラスのダイアログメンバ変数へ接続したい場合どうしたらいいです
か?

apple::メンバ変数とかしても、クラスまたは構造体ではありませんときます・・・。

MFCです。ちなみにこの3つのクラスは、親子でもなんでもないです。

誰か助けて;;


引用未解決
トピックタグ
επιστημη
 επιστημη
(@επιστημη)
ゲスト
結合: 22年前
投稿: 1301
 

接続するを説明してください。


返信引用
wclrp ( 'o')
 wclrp ( 'o')
(@wclrp ( 'o'))
ゲスト
結合: 18年前
投稿: 287
 

推測で回答
オブジェクトで考えてほしい

たとえば
int a;
long b;
において値を渡したいとします。

long = int;
では値を渡すことができないというか
コンパイルエラーになります。

クラスは変数ではなく型です。
apple::メンバ変数 = 5;
のようなことはできません。
但しクラス変数とかstatic(静的)メンバ変数と呼ばれるものを除く。

たとえば
apple a;
a.メンバ変数 = 5;
apple * p = &a;
p->メンバ変数 = 5;
のような使い方になります。


返信引用
クロス
 クロス
(@クロス)
ゲスト
結合: 17年前
投稿: 2
Topic starter  

 ありがとうございました。
(’’さんの結構参考になりました。(^^
(''顔さんおもしろいですね^^


返信引用
PATIO
(@patio)
Famed Member
結合: 3年前
投稿: 2660
 

既に見てないかもですが、

もしC++言語の文法の勉強を全くしていない状態で
いきなりプログラミングをしようとしているなら
本を買ってきて文法の勉強をした方が良いと思います。
文法がわからないとソースを提示されても読めませんし、
行き当たりばったりになってしまうので。
何かを組むのであれば、文法の基礎が理解できてからの方が
良いと思いますよ。


返信引用

返信する

投稿者名

投稿者メールアドレス

タイトル *

プレビュー 0リビジョン 保存しました
共有:
タイトルとURLをコピーしました